Your week on the TSX

This week, Tenaz Energy Corp. (TNZ.TO) emerged as the top gainer on the TSX, climbing 12.48% to close at $73.27. Meanwhile, Thomson Reuters Corp (TRI.TO) faced significant pressure, dropping 13.92% to end the week at $132.53.

Tenaz Energy Corp. continues to show strong operational performance, with a reported 6% increase in production to 17,125 boe/d for Q2 2026. This growth is attributed to both organic development and strategic acquisitions, bolstering investor confidence.

Thomson Reuters Corp. has been under pressure following the approval of its return of capital and share consolidation transactions. The market's reaction appears to reflect concerns over the implications of this restructuring on shareholder value.

PDI.TO: PDI Gold Limited (PDI.TO) saw an 11.53% increase this week, closing at $4.74. This rise comes amid ongoing developments in its mining operations, which have attracted investor interest.

IVN.TO: Ivanhoe Mines Ltd. (IVN.TO) gained 9.52% this week, despite a 5.13% decline on the last day of trading. The company remains a key player in the mining sector, with ongoing projects that continue to draw attention.
